Chinese Shrimp and Scallops with Garlic Sauce

Makes 4 generous servings.

3/4 lb. scallops
3/4 lb. medium shrimp, shelled and deveined
1/2 lb. snow peas
3/8 lb. broccoli florets
5 garlic cloves, sliced
1/2 teaspoon chicken bouillon dissolved in 1/2 cup water
1 tablespoon starch in a thin paste in cold water
oil
soy sauce

Fry the garlic in the oil until it just shows signs of browning. Add the scallops and the shrimp. Cook on as high heat as possible until the scallops turn white and the shrimp pink, turning constantly (about 5 minutes). Add the vegetables. Heat for a minute, then sprinkle with soy sauce. Add about 1/4 cup of the bouillon, then thicken the juices in the bottom of the wok with the starch paste. Continue to toss rapidly for a few minutes until everything is hot and covered with the sauce. Serve immediately.
